WebWhile myoglobin and haemoglobin are both oxygen-storing molecules, myoglobin has a higher affinity for oxygen than haemoglobin (Figure 2). As a result, haemoglobin gives up oxygen to myoglobin, especially at low pH. This behaviour is particularly important during an intense muscular activity where there will be a shortage of oxygen, and muscles will … WebA number of factors influence the myoglobin content of skeletal muscles. Muscles are a mixture of two different types of muscle fibre, fast-twitch and slow-twitch, which vary in proportions between muscles. Fast-twitch fibres have a low myoglobin content and are therefore also called white fibres. They are dependent on anaerobic glycolysis for energy …

WebSep 19, 2024 · The overall density of mitochondria in muscle tissue increases in response to aerobic workouts. More mitochondria means greater use of oxygen to produce more ATP and energy. Aerobic exercise also leads to an increase in myoglobin in muscle tissue. WebOct 3, 2024 · The most common symptoms of rhabdomyolysis include: Muscle weakness. Muscle aches. Dark urine. The muscle damage causes inflammation leading to tenderness, swelling, and weakness of the affected muscles. The dark urine color is due to myoglobin being excreted in the urine.
